본문 바로가기
Programming/Python

[Python] Python 기본 강의 (7) - 리스트 활용하기

by 코딩의성지 2019. 11. 16.

하이~~~ 진짜 오랜만에 개발 관련 포스팅을한다.

 

사내에서 진행한 공모전에 최근에 나갔는데 2등을 했다 !! ㅎㅎㅎ 일등을 못해서 쪼오금 아쉽긴하지만 그래도 만족한다.

 

자 내얘기는 이정도하고 ... 오늘은 지난번에 사용해봤던 리스트를 조금더 보려고한다.

 

리스트 사용방법이 궁금하다면

https://devkingdom.tistory.com/40

 

[Python] Python 기본 강의 (6) - 리스트 사용하기( 삽입, 수정 삭제 등)

안녕 ~~ ㅎㅎ 빨리 크롤링 공부 들어가야하는데 ...ㅜㅡㅜ 파이썬 공부 할 양이 많아서 큰일이다. 그래도 힘내서 하나하나 정리하며 공부해보겠다. 대학교 다닐때 컴퓨터공학이나 유사 전공을 하신분들이라면 자료..

devkingdom.tistory.com

읽어보고 와주면 좋겠다.

 

문자열 자르기

 

예전에 문자열 관련된 파이썬 강의 글을 올리면서 얘기할까하다가 리스트와 연관이있어 지금 이렇게 적는다.

문자열은 보통 split라는 함수를 사용해서 자를 수가 있다. 이때 잘린 스트링값들은 리스트 형태로 저장된다.

 

무슨말인지 모르겠다고? 그래서 아래 예제를 준비했다. 예제를 보면 엄청 쉬울꺼다 ㅎㅎ

 

예제를 보면 공백을 기준으로 문자열이 잘려서 리스트로 저장된 걸 볼 수 있다.

 

 

위의 예제처럼 split의 파라미터로 특정 문자를 넣어주면 그 파라미터를 기준으로 값을 자르는걸 볼 수 있다.

 

정렬

 

그리고 파이썬에서는 리스트의 정렬을 정말 편하게 쓸수 있다.

예제를 보면서 설명해주겠다.

 

sort라는 함수를 통해서 오름차순으로 정렬을 할 수 있다. 그리고 내림차순으로 정렬을 하기 위해서는 파라미터에 reverse=True를 넣어줘야한다. 그리고 간혹 reverse함수가 내림차순을 하는 거라고 생각하시는 분이 있는데 아니다!!

 

reverse 함수는 단순히 리스트를 뒤집는 역할이다 주의하자.

 

오늘은 간단하게 이정도만 보고 가자!! 그럼 오늘도 즐거운 코딩하자 !!

반응형

댓글